1. Pleadings in this matter are complete.

2. It appears that the request of the National Law University (NLU), Jodhpur to grant recognition to the Cyber Law Course, provided by distance education, was rejected by the UGC, against which the NLU, Jodhpur preferred an appeal, which was also rejected.

3. Mr. Anand Varma, learned Counsel appearing for the NLU submits that his client is in the process of challenging the said rejection as well.

5. In the meanwhile, the NLU, Jodhpur is directed to place on record the decision of the UGC as well as the decision which was passed in the appeal preferred by them under cover of an appropriate affidavit after providing copies thereof to learned Counsel for the petitioner.

6. Renotify on 26 February 2024.
